#463b73 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#463b73 is composed of 27.5% red, 23.1%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.1% cyan, 48.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 251.8 degrees, a saturation of 32.2% and a lightness of 34.1%. #463b73 color hex could be obtained by blending #8c76e6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#463b73 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#463b73 has RGB values of R:70, G:59, B:115 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0.49, Y:0,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 4602739.
